I have to confront a 50 Hz (20 ms of period) pressure signal with a 5 Hz temperature signal (200 ms of period) to calculate the density. I would like to create 10 repeats of one temperature value. I was thinking to use a for cycle but I don't know how. Can anyone give me some suggestions? Thank you!

I do not clearly understand what you want to do.
However, if you want both signals to have the same sampling frequency, use the resample function on one of them (preferably the one with the higher sampling frequency to resample it to a lower sampling frequency).
If you want to repeat one of the signals, use the repmat function.
